
When John Hinderer bought a Honda dealership in Heath, Ohio from an existing dealer in 1991, it was in the middle of a wheat field. The business wasn’t faring very well and Honda wasn’t sure the location would bring in much traffic – after all, it hadn’t before. Well, John subscribed to the ‘if you build it, they will come’ school of thought, so he moved forward and started anew at the original location at 1010 Hebron Road. Coming from the banking business, and then an account executive for WBNS-TV, John was a little worried about moving out on his own. At the same time, though, he was excited for this new opportunity, selling the best thing available: the Honda brand.
Soon after, John found he had the aptitude for selling Hondas! He moved up the road a tad to 1515 Hebron Road in 2000. He got some help when the road in front of his business was widened and prospective Honda buyers started making the drive to Heath. John’s current campus now also features the Power Store, selling motorcycles, ATVs, watercraft, scooters and utility vehicles. If it’s got wheels, John Hinderer’s campus has it! He also has some loyal staff who’ve enjoyed the ride and are still part of Hinderer Honda from its early days.
